Why These Are the Top Flooring Installers Contractors in Alberta

The flooring installer market in and around Alberta, Virginia, is characterized by a small number of highly established local and regional contractors rather than high-volume national chains. Due to Alberta's rural nature, homeowners typically rely on providers from nearby commercial hubs like South Hill and Lawrenceville. The competition level is moderate, with a focus on reputation and word-of-mouth referrals over marketing. The average quality of service is high, as the long-standing businesses rely on community trust. Typical pricing is competitive for the region, with project costs largely dependent on material choice. For example, professional installation of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P) can range from $4-$7 per square foot, while refinishing hardwood floors averages $3-$6 per square foot, excluding material costs. Most reputable contractors are licensed, insured, and have been operating for over a decade, providing a stable and experienced market for consumers.

1How does Alberta, Virginia's climate affect my choice of flooring material?

Alberta, VA experiences a humid subtropical climate with hot, humid summers and mild winters, which can cause wood floors to expand and contract. For this reason, engineered hardwood is often a more stable choice than solid hardwood. Moisture-resistant options like luxury vinyl plank (LVP) or tile are also excellent for handling the humidity, especially in basements or ground-level rooms prone to dampness.

2What is the typical timeline for a flooring installation project in the Southside Virginia region?

For a standard-sized room, professional installation typically takes 1-2 days, but project timelines can extend due to material availability and contractor scheduling. In Alberta and surrounding Brunswick County, it's wise to book services several weeks in advance, especially in spring and fall, which are popular renovation seasons. Always factor in an extra day for furniture moving, subfloor preparation, and acclimating materials to your home's humidity levels.

3Are there specific permits or regulations for flooring installation in Alberta, VA?

Generally, simple flooring replacement does not require a permit in Alberta or Brunswick County. However, if your installation involves significant structural changes to the subfloor, or if you are in a historic district, you should check with the Brunswick County Building Inspections office. A reputable local installer will know these regulations and handle any necessary compliance for major projects.

4How do I choose a reliable flooring installer in the Alberta area?

Look for licensed, insured contractors with strong local references in Brunswick County. Verify their experience with your specific material (e.g., hardwood, LVP, carpet) and ask for proof of liability and workers' compensation insurance. It's also beneficial to choose a provider familiar with local suppliers and the common subfloor types found in older Virginia homes, such as pier and beam foundations.

5What are common cost factors for flooring installation in this part of Virginia?

Costs vary by material (e.g., carpet vs. hardwood), room size, and subfloor condition. In the Alberta region, labor rates are competitive, but you should budget for potential subfloor repairs, which are common in older homes. Always get a detailed, written estimate that includes removal/disposal of old flooring, materials, labor, and any necessary moisture barriers or underlayment specific to our climate.
